CCPS Athletes Represent in Region 2 All-Star Soccer Victory

Over the weekend, three CCPS students were chosen to play in the 2nd Annual Region 2 VS. Region 3 All Star Soccer game at Apollo High School in Owensboro, KY. Participation was based on a voting system by all coaches in the region. Two Christian County High School students, senior, Christian Lopez and junior, Mason Malone were voted in. 11th grade student, Alex Ramirez represented Hopkinsville High School. Compiled from student-athletes from Webster County, Henderson County, Madisonville-North Hopkins, University Heights Academy, Christian County, and Hopkinsville High Schools, the Second Region team held strong through the first half to leave the score at 3-1 before half-time. The Third Region found their stride during the second half, but it wasn’t enough for the upset. Winning the game, the 2nd region added two more goals to have the game end 5-4.

Notable Stats:
Christian Lopez: Lopez is ranked 39th in the state for assists (0.8 average)
Mason Malone: Ranked 50th for Goalkeeper Saves 142 (7.1 average per game), Ranked 23rd for Goalkeeper Complete Game Shutouts (8)
*Stats pulled from KHSAA 2024 Boys Soccer Stat Leaders
